The global healthcare education solutions market, valued at $8,515.7 million in 2025, is poised for robust growth, projected to expand at a Compound Annual Growth Rate (CAGR) of 5.2% from 2025 to 2033. This growth is fueled by several key drivers. The increasing prevalence of chronic diseases necessitates continuous professional development for healthcare professionals, driving demand for advanced training and upskilling programs. Technological advancements, particularly in e-learning platforms and simulation tools, are enhancing the accessibility and effectiveness of healthcare education, further boosting market expansion. Furthermore, stringent regulatory requirements for continuing medical education (CME) and the growing adoption of telehealth are significantly contributing to market growth. The market is segmented by delivery mode (classroom-based and e-learning) and medical specialty (cardiology, internal medicine, radiology, neurology, and pediatrics), with e-learning experiencing particularly rapid growth due to its flexibility and cost-effectiveness. Competition is intense, with major players such as GE Healthcare, Siemens Healthineers, and Philips actively investing in innovative solutions and expanding their global reach. Geographic expansion, particularly in emerging markets with growing healthcare infrastructure and a rising number of medical professionals, presents significant opportunities for market expansion.
The market's growth trajectory is influenced by several factors. While the aforementioned drivers contribute positively, challenges remain. High implementation costs associated with advanced simulation technologies and the digital divide in certain regions could hinder market penetration. However, ongoing innovation in affordable and accessible e-learning platforms and government initiatives supporting healthcare education are expected to mitigate these restraints. The North American market currently holds a significant share, owing to its advanced healthcare infrastructure and high adoption of cutting-edge technologies. However, Asia-Pacific is expected to witness the fastest growth over the forecast period, driven by increasing healthcare expenditure and a rapidly growing medical workforce in countries like India and China. This dynamic interplay of drivers, restraints, and regional variations indicates a promising yet complex landscape for healthcare education solutions providers in the coming years.

Several key factors are propelling the growth of the healthcare education solutions market. The escalating prevalence of chronic diseases necessitates a larger, more highly skilled healthcare workforce capable of effectively managing complex patient populations. This increased demand necessitates comprehensive and continuous professional development programs. Technological advancements, particularly in e-learning platforms, virtual reality simulations, and AI-powered learning tools, are significantly enhancing the quality and accessibility of healthcare education. These technologies cater to diverse learning styles and preferences while facilitating cost-effective and scalable training solutions. Government regulations and initiatives aimed at improving healthcare quality and patient safety are driving investment in healthcare education and training. Many nations are implementing mandatory continuing medical education (CME) requirements, fueling demand for high-quality educational resources. Furthermore, the adoption of value-based care models is incentivizing healthcare providers to enhance their skills and knowledge to optimize patient outcomes and reduce costs. This necessitates continuous learning and adaptation, driving the demand for ongoing healthcare education solutions. Finally, the growing emphasis on personalized medicine necessitates specialized training for healthcare professionals, further contributing to market growth.
Despite significant growth potential, the healthcare education solutions market faces several challenges. The high cost of developing and implementing advanced educational technologies, such as virtual reality simulations and AI-powered learning platforms, can pose a significant barrier to entry for smaller players. Maintaining the quality and relevance of educational content in a rapidly evolving healthcare landscape requires significant investment in ongoing research, development, and curriculum updates. Ensuring effective integration of new technologies into existing healthcare education systems can also be complex and time-consuming, requiring careful planning and implementation. The need to address the digital divide and ensure equitable access to high-quality healthcare education for professionals in underserved areas presents another significant challenge. Finally, the regulatory landscape surrounding healthcare education can be complex and vary significantly across different regions, posing challenges for providers seeking to operate in multiple markets. Competition from established educational institutions and the need to demonstrate a clear return on investment for educational programs also present challenges to market growth.
The North American market is projected to dominate the healthcare education solutions market throughout the forecast period, driven by high healthcare expenditure, advanced technological infrastructure, and a strong emphasis on continuing medical education. Within North America, the United States is expected to hold a leading position, due to its large and sophisticated healthcare system. However, significant growth is also anticipated in the Asia-Pacific region, fueled by expanding healthcare infrastructure, rising healthcare expenditure, and a growing need for skilled healthcare professionals.
Segment Dominance: E-learning is poised for significant growth, outpacing classroom-based training, primarily due to its flexibility, accessibility, cost-effectiveness, and potential for wider reach. Within applications, Cardiology and Radiology are anticipated to lead due to the rapid advancements and complexity in these fields, requiring specialized, continuous training.
